The size of Arana Hills is approximately 3.7 square kilometres. There are 31 parks, covering nearly 20.8% of the total area. The population of Arana Hills in 2016 was 6810 people. By 2021 the population was 6971 showing a population growth of 2.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Arana Hills is 30-39 years. Households in Arana Hills are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Arana Hills work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 78.80% of the homes in Arana Hills were owner-occupied compared with 78.90% in 2016.
